The Phinehas stood up
and intervened,
and the plague was stayed.
Psalm 106. 30
(Phinehas knew it was
time to pray, to intercede,
to do something
about the turmoil
or the brokenness,
to bring peace as best
as he was able.
Prayer is not
an optional activity,
nor an excuse not to act,
but the most vital element
in our response.
Prayer makes us aware,
not just to a solution,
but to the Presence
of the Almighty.
The most profound thing
we can do is pray.
When Phinehas prayed,
God gave him
the courage to stand.)
